Workplace regulators in California are drafting an emergency rule to address an epidemic of silicosis — a deadly, preventable lung disease — among fabricators of artificial-stone countertops.
One of the men featured in the stories, Juan Gonzalez Morin, died last month. He had just turned 37.
Since 2019, the California Department of Public Health has identified 69 cases of silicosis among fabrication workers — “likely an underestimate,”

Things To Avoid On Your Granite Countertops
There are many ways you can keep your countertops safe from being stained or from being damaged. Like any other countertops, your granite countertops may be strong as a brick, but there are many ways you can erode the surface of this stone and make it wear down. There are many ways you can protect your home from damage, and the first thing you will want to learn about is things that you should avoid placing on your granite directly. There are combinations of food and chemicals that can wear down the colour of your granite, they also have the potential to eat away at your stone, leaving you with a rough surface.
You will want to avoid putting raw meat directly on your granite counters;. However, your granite counters are micro-sealed to prevent mycobacteria from working their way into the surface of the stone. Would you really want to risk it? Imagine after you drop raw meat on your counter, micro bacteria work their way to the surface affecting every food which touches the countertops. You will have more of a chance of becoming serey ill, and there is a chance you may even get salmonella. You want to avoid placing acidic items on your countertops; this includes citrus fruits, soft drinks and nail polish.
You will want to clean spills as fast as you can; although spills are inevitable and they happen almost every time, there's no way that you couldn't fix your countertops with a little bit of hot water and soap. You will want to avoid placing knives directly on top of your countertops, and this is because you do not want to knick the stone or make an indent in the countertop. If you are ever going to cut vegetables or fruits, make sure to place a cutting board underneath the knife. You should never directly cut foods on your countertop, you never know when your hand will slip and you could injure yourself.
